Job Summary

We are seeking Processing Technicians who will be responsible for safely and effectively filling, packaging and labeling our cannabis products.

Duties and responsibilities or (Essential Functions)

  • Cross-trains on and working alongside with the Processing team with the weighing, and packaging of PharmaCann’s broad cannabis product line
  • Cleans any/all production areas to ensure no cross contamination occurs
  • Follows the SOP’s in regard to documenting your daily work on daily recap sheet
  • Follows appropriate control measures to prevent mixing of cannabis strains and batches, and/or weights of batches
  • Aspires to learn the components of the plant
  • Performing his/her duties in a safe manner and environment while adhering to all governmental regulations for this industry
  • Carrying out all weighing and packaging operations in an efficient manner that also complies with all GMP’s, OSHA regulations, PharmaCann SOP’s and all applicable required procedures
  • Ensuring 100% compliance and accuracy involving all product tracking, product security, and product movement procedures
  • Performing in-process and post-process quality assurance testing and conducting visual inspections to ensure all product meets or exceed PharmaCann’s specifications and patients’ expectations. Such quality assurance work and reporting shall include but not be limited to:
    • Recording and monitoring process conditions to ensure compliance to standard operating procedures o Proper weighing, data recording, and batch tracking throughout PharmaCann’s process
    • Continually strive and work with the remainder of the Production Team to improve PharmaCann’s processes for improved patient safety, quality, and efficient manufacturing
    • Assist in monitoring processing supplies and inventory
    • Train and pass test on Food safety certification
    • Assists in the Formulation area with the filling and capping of all formulated products.
    • Assist with food production
  • Performs other duties as assigned
  • Provide coverage in the warehousing and cultivation departments, as business needs require
  • Projects a positive image of the organization to employees, customers, industry, and community
  • Embodies the culture, values, and tenets of PharmaCann and full support of our purpose, goal, and key objectives

Qualifications

  • High School Diploma or G.E.D minimum
  • State law requires that applicants be 21 years old to work for cultivation center
  • One (1) to three(3) years of manufacturing and packaging experience with a focus on ensuring product safety, consumer safety and satisfaction, and high product quality
  • Attention to detail
  • Effective communication skills
  • Strong work ethic
  • Willingness to learn and improve each operation
  • Ability to perform repetitive tasks for long periods of time (i.e., trimming plants, weighing product, and regular inventory)

Working conditions

  • Requires weekend/holidays altering rotation
  • Requires overtime according to business needs
  • Must remove all jewelry, including rings, brooches, watches, pins, earrings, necklaces and visible piercings. In addition, false nails, nail polish, false eyelashes and any other object that may possibly contaminate food is not allowed in the processing/production areas
  • Requires work in varying temperature-controlled environments

Physical requirements

Standing, walking, bending, working with hands/arms at an extended horizontally or above head position for long periods and lifting up to 50 pounds, lifting/carrying product totes, pushing carts, moving and making adjustments to process equipment.
